How do I generate/activate the CIF integration models?

How do I CIF some materials?

How do I cross-check if the transfer took place?

Hello Pooja,

1. Use transaction CFM1, select check boxes 'Plant', 'Material'. Enter the plants and the Materials you want to transfer to APO. without plant being in APO you cannot transfer Materials as Products to APO.

Save your integration model.

2. Activate this model using transaction CFM2. you can see this by checking the status which gets displayed against the model.

after successful activation you get a log also displayed which gives information of the transfer, error, warning or information messages.

3. you can check in APO, in transaction /SAPAPO/MAT1 or in /SAPAPO/RRP3 whether the material - plant combination has been transferred or not.

You can use following tcodes:

CFM1 (Create integration models)

CFM2 (Activate/Deactivate models)

You can see data transfers in smq1 and smq2 and also you can check in apo if you are transferring the data from R/3.

For example if you are transferring the materials you can see the data in apo by using /n/sapapo/rrp3.

I am unable to check if I activated the integration models properly..

Please suggest as to how I shud confirm if I activated them right.

Transaction /SAPAPO/CC

Settings

ECC Client - APO Client

Integration Model

If your integration model is in status "Active" all the integration models have been correctly activated in ECC.
